Transaction 651e43e2c40ab4bc27ccc863de7316e7039f1ae94c2aba57b509b9290a0fa786
1 Input
1 Output
-
651e43e2c40ab4bc27ccc863de7316e7039f1ae94c2aba57b509b9290a0fa786:0
- value
- 580896
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 667b359b9a0a9f05e26141fc8afcfddedf6c8c31 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ALsXJmKsa4n4Cy7ioQwERU2KVZrivs65Z